/**
* Simulates/validates a contract interaction. This is useful for retrieving **return data** and **revert reasons** of contract write functions.
*
* - Docs: https://viem.sh/docs/contract/simulateContract.html
* - Examples: https://stackblitz.com/github/wevm/viem/tree/main/examples/contracts/writing-to-contracts
*
* This function does not require gas to execute and _**does not**_ change the state of the blockchain. It is almost identical to [`readContract`](https://viem.sh/docs/contract/readContract.html), but also supports contract write functions.
*
* Internally, uses a [Public Client](https://viem.sh/docs/clients/public.html) to call the [`call` action](https://viem.sh/docs/actions/public/call.html) with [ABI-encoded `data`](https://viem.sh/docs/contract/encodeFunctionData.html).
*
* @param client - Client to use
* @param parameters - {@link SimulateContractParameters}
* @returns The simulation result and write request. {@link SimulateContractReturnType}
*
* @example
* import { createPublicClient, http } from 'viem'
* import { mainnet } from 'viem/chains'
* import { simulateContract } from 'viem/contract'
*
* const client = createPublicClient({
* chain: mainnet,
* transport: http(),
* })
* const result = await simulateContract(client, {
* address: '0xFBA3912Ca04dd458c843e2EE08967fC04f3579c2',
* abi: parseAbi(['function mint(uint32) view returns (uint32)']),
* functionName: 'mint',
* args: ['69420'],
* account: '0xA0Cf798816D4b9b9866b5330EEa46a18382f251e',
* })
*/
